Gigameter to Angstrom Conversion Formula
One gigameter is equal to 1e+19 angstrom.
Manual Calculation to Convert 30 gm to å
To convert 30 gigameter to angstrom, multiply the value by the conversion factor: 1e+19. As one gigameter is equal to 1e+19 angstrom, therefore,
30 gm x 1e+19 = 3e+20 angstrom
So, 30 gigameter = 3e+20 angstrom
